Why do front wheel drive EVs exist? by [deleted] in electricvehicles

[–]IntelligentBody5891 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Regen capability. More room in the front for a larger motor and/or service room. Allows for a front charging port to keep major electrical components all in the same area and simple/less expense.

Traction benifits or drawbacks are likely negligible due to weight distribution.

Every playthrough I end up following same vicious circle by Kumagor0 in valheim

[–]IntelligentBody5891 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Building new bases comes with the territory — there’s always a better spot for a base. It never ends. Best to embrace it.

I’ve found three things help. First, build small and efficient. Put storage in the floor. Maximize every square inch. Anybody can build a big base. It takes real skill to be creative with as little space as possible. You can do a lot with even just a 4x4 building. If the draugr can manage with simple buildings, so can you.

The second thing is practice. In order to make an efficient building, practice makes perfect. I go into creative and build a 5x5 house. Or a 7x7. Or a 9x4 longhouse. Something basic I can re-create. So when I play with friends, I can immediately say: “my longhouse blueprint would fit great here” and not have to make every build custom. You can always improvise later, but start from a recipe you know.

The third thing is to build villages, not castles. Building a single large building is great, but it makes remodel a pain. Build a storage structure in the middle, a rest bonus/portal structure and a kitchen building. Then add buildings as needed, protecting them with a wall. It’s easy to expand a small building. And it’s easy to expand a wall when compared to a giant unwieldy single structure.
